"Aww, look how pretty he is, Jasper!" Brett beamed that wide, eye-crinkling smile of his --honestly just beyond the moon to have been involved in.. well, something. 

Cortado looked less enthused and more tired than anything. The chestnut stallion stood with his back hoof up and his eyelids and head drooping, semi-braided tail swishing this way and that to combat the very last of the flies that had decided to hang on through the chill of autumn's onset. Today, they were shooting photographs of him. His ribbons hung proudly from his bridle and reins --bright splashes of colour that both clashed and blended magnificently with the stark row of deciduous trees in full gold and red behind him. He'd worked hard in the jumping arena to take home the bounty that he had, and even Jasper --who usually prided himself in his indifference to the general happenings of Moors Hollow--felt quite proud of the amiable Swedish Warmblood. 

This season hadn't been easy on the stallion, and Kylie had seemed quite frustrated with him the further they'd gotten into their local show listings. He had drive, for sure, but he always seemed to come in second, and as proud as Jasper was for the big lump of a horse, he knew that it caused his owner endless aggravation. She'd contemplated gelding him after his season had come to a close, but seemed to reconsider after he'd finally taken home a red ribbon in his third Maiden Jumper course of the year. It was on that note that she decided to let 'Tado rest while he was ahead, but Jasper was still quite optimistic about his future.

Sure, 'Tado would never be a flashy heel-snapping jumper gunning for gold in the Olympics, but Jasper was under the impression that the tubby big guy practically flew for how deceptively lazy he was. Tuesday and Outcry were more stereotypical as far as Show Jumping temperaments went, but 'Tado was something very special. He was a horse that could be trusted with smalls, and no matter the rider, he'd be more than happy to plod around the arena like the great hulking teddy bear he was. Throw an experienced rider on him and point him towards a jump though and.. well, he lit up. The stallion had more than enough heart to take on even the most intimidating of jumps, but Jasper knew that he could never truly go head-to-head with a quicker, more agile horse like Tuesday. 

"Get his head up, yeah?" The American chuckled as he peered over top of the camera he'd managed to borrow from Kylie for the day. Brett was more than happy to oblige, though he had considerable difficulty given that 'Tado looked as though he might have been asleep and definitely wanted to stay that way. "Grab a handful of grass and hold it up or something." 

The teenager reached down to rip up a small patch of Moors Hollow, to Jasper's utter amusement, and gently tapped it against 'Tado's semi-pink nose. Both eyes, big and brown, opened just a little wider, and the stallion's ears swung forward as his lips automatically went reaching for the snack. Brett beamed at that, and held his hand up higher as he took a step backwards --just enough for the chestnut to start to lean forward--and with that, the winning shot was taken.

"He's ridiculous, and I like him." Brett laughed, wrist tilting down to allow the horse his treat. Jasper just shook his head, but he couldn't help but agree.
